Not quite a barn find but a couple more years under the tarpaulin and it would be harder to recover. Every surface needs refinishing. The engine internals are in great condition which is testament to the owner who had it serviced regularly. It's a one owner, UK bike with 23000 miles. Unfortunately I never met the owner as he passed away but uncannily I bought his last two bikes without ever knowing. In 1980 he traded a Z1000 in for this Z1300 at Northampton Kawasaki. I purchased the Z1000 and had it for 5 years. 44 years later I purchased his Z1300 from his widow which he'd had all those years after the Z1000. How spooky is that; it was meant to be?
